कलातीतं निर्वशगं निर्व्यापारं महत्परम् । विश्वाधारं जगन्मध्यं कोटिब्रह्मांडबीजकम्
kalātītaṃ nirvaśagaṃ nirvyāpāraṃ mahatparam | viśvādhāraṃ jaganmadhyaṃ koṭibrahmāṃḍabījakam
Melampaui segala kala dan ukuran, merdeka dan tanpa kegiatan, Mahatinggi lagi agung—penopang semesta, pusat jagat, benih bagi tak terhitung brahmāṇḍa.
